在当今这个信息技术飞速发展的时代,企业级分布式系统已成为许多企业的核心竞争力。然而,随着系统规模的不断扩大,监控成本也在不断增加。如何有效优化企业级分布式系统监控成本,成为了许多企业亟待解决的问题。本文将深入探讨企业级分布式系统监控成本优化策略,并结合实际案例进行分享。
一、分布式系统监控成本优化的意义
- 降低成本:通过优化监控成本,企业可以节省大量的资金投入,将资源更多地投入到系统核心竞争力的提升上。
- 提高效率:优化后的监控体系可以更加高效地发现和解决问题,从而提高系统的稳定性。
- 提升用户体验:稳定的系统可以为企业带来更好的用户体验,增强客户满意度。
二、企业级分布式系统监控成本优化策略
1. 选择合适的监控工具
- 功能全面性:选择功能全面、易于扩展的监控工具,以满足企业级分布式系统的需求。
- 性能优越性:选择性能优越的监控工具,确保监控数据采集、处理和展示的实时性。
- 易用性:选择易于使用和维护的监控工具,降低运维成本。
2. 监控数据采集优化
- 数据采集策略:根据业务需求,合理制定数据采集策略,避免采集过多无用数据。
- 数据压缩:对采集到的数据进行压缩,减少存储空间和传输带宽的占用。
- 数据缓存:对高频访问的数据进行缓存,提高数据读取效率。
3. 监控数据存储优化
- 数据分区:对监控数据进行分区存储,提高查询效率。
- 数据压缩:对存储数据进行压缩,降低存储空间占用。
- 冷热数据分离:将冷数据和热数据分离存储,提高存储系统性能。
4. 监控数据展示优化
- 可视化:采用可视化技术,将监控数据以图表、图形等形式展示,提高数据可读性。
- 自定义报表:提供自定义报表功能,满足不同用户的需求。
- 实时监控:实现实时监控,及时发现和解决问题。
5. 监控系统集成优化
- 模块化设计:采用模块化设计,提高系统可扩展性和可维护性。
- API接口:提供API接口,方便与其他系统集成。
- 自动化部署:实现自动化部署,提高运维效率。
三、案例分析
以下是一个企业级分布式系统监控成本优化案例:
企业背景:某大型电商平台,拥有海量用户和业务数据,系统规模庞大,监控成本较高。
优化策略:
- 选择合适的监控工具:采用某知名监控工具,具备全面的功能、优越的性能和易用性。
- 监控数据采集优化:针对业务需求,合理制定数据采集策略,并对数据进行压缩和缓存。
- 监控数据存储优化:对监控数据进行分区存储,并采用数据压缩和冷热数据分离技术。
- 监控数据展示优化:采用可视化技术,提供自定义报表和实时监控功能。
- 监控系统集成优化:采用模块化设计,提供API接口和自动化部署功能。
优化效果:
- 监控成本降低:通过优化,监控成本降低了30%。
- 系统稳定性提高:系统稳定性提高了20%,故障率降低了50%。
- 用户体验提升:用户满意度提高了15%,订单转化率提升了10%。
四、总结
企业级分布式系统监控成本优化是一项复杂的系统工程,需要综合考虑多个因素。通过选择合适的监控工具、优化监控数据采集、存储和展示,以及系统集成,可以有效降低监控成本,提高系统稳定性和用户体验。希望本文的分享能够为企业级分布式系统监控成本优化提供一些有益的参考。
